Sep 26, 2016What type of application is it? Is it HTTP based? Is it unencrypted? Can you use F5 Cookie Insert?
For any type of persistence, there MUST be something to key off of or look at to make the persistence decision so please share what you would like to look at in the request.
Example, for source persistence, we key off of the source IP.
In HTTP persistence, we can key off of a hostname ,or uri or cookie, etc..
What do you propose we look at in the request?
